A Generic Flow Algorithm for Shared Filter Ordering Problems

Summary: Flow-maximization for evaluating overlapping conjunctive boolean queries with shared filters on heterogeneous parallel processors, maximizing throughput under processor capacity constraints. Generic iterative algorithm uses a single-processor min-cost filter-ordering oracle to build parallel plans while preserving essentially the oracle’s approximation ratio, enabling many filter-ordering variants to be optimized in parallel.
